Stephanie Barfuss, LCSW, LAC
Founder and Psychotherapist
Stephanie is a Licensed Clinical Social Worker and Licensed Addiction Counselor in Montana. She founded Barefoot Mental Wellness to offer adults a calm, collaborative space for meaningful change.
She works with adults seeking support around anxiety, stress, emotional well-being, substance use and recovery, life transitions, and patterns that feel difficult to shift alone.
Stephanie’s approach balances careful listening and reflection with practical tools. She respects each client’s pace, values, and lived experience while helping them move forward in ways that feel realistic and sustainable.
In addition to psychotherapy and substance use counseling, Stephanie provides mental health evaluations and chemical dependency evaluations.
Ginger Connelly, ACLC, CBHPSS
Addiction Counselor License Candidate
Certified Behavioral Health Peer Support Specialist
Founding Team Member
Ginger provides individual substance use counseling, chemical dependency evaluations, and behavioral health peer support services for primarily adult clients. Substance use counseling and chemical dependency evaluations may be offered in person in Missoula or through telehealth when appropriate. Peer support is currently offered in person only.
Her work is recovery-oriented, strengths-based, and grounded in dignity and collaboration. Ginger supports people who are exploring their relationship with substances, working toward change, maintaining recovery, or seeking practical support and connection.
As an Addiction Counselor License Candidate, Ginger practices within applicable supervision requirements. As a Certified Behavioral Health Peer Support Specialist, she also offers peer support focused on recovery resources, self-advocacy, personal strengths, and meaningful next steps.
Ginger joined Barefoot Mental Wellness as a Founding Team Member and is helping shape the practice’s growing substance use and recovery services.
